Arbolit
Properties and main advantages
Wood concrete is a lightweight construction material created on the basis of concrete and wood filler. At the stage of mixing the solution, sawdust, straw dust or hemp fiber are introduced into it, which contributes to the formation of a durable composite with excellent performance characteristics.

Tip! If possible, choose products with a large fraction of the filler. Wood chips are better than sawdust, and even more - better than chopped straw, and copes with heat saving, and with the strengthening of the solution.
The advantages of arbolita include:
- Effective thermal insulation. The material with which the internal pores of the blocks are filled has a low thermal conductivity, thanks to which the walls themselves act as an energy-saving layer.
- High mechanical strength. Despite the fact that arbolit is quite easy, laying out of it does not need additional reinforcement. At the same time, the material itself is relatively simply processed, so diamond drilling of holes in concrete for laying communication channels is definitely not needed.
Note! An additional plus is the convenience of cladding. The blocks do not crumble under mechanical action, because the panels can be attached to them with ordinary anchors.
- Good climatic characteristics. Cellulose, which is part of the solution, has a high hygroscopicity, because the walls in some way regulate the humidity inside the room.
- Despite the high content of wood components, the blocks do not burn. Of course, about full fire resistance (resistance to temperatures over 1000 0C) there is no need to speak, but this is quite enough to ensure a basic level of fire safety.

The drawbacks of wood concrete in construction
Of course, there are arbolita and cons:
- First, it is still desirable to protect the pulp blocks from moisture. Otherwise, with constant wetting, it will begin to swell and then decompose.
- Secondly, the loose filler does not allow to give the arbolit blocks a perfectly even shape. That is why, doing the laying with your own hands, you need to control the position of each row in terms of level and plumb, and correct any distortions.
- Well, finally - the cost. Here, the dispute "what is better arbolit or expanded clay concrete and other porous compositions" is decided unequivocally not in favor of the first.

What to choose?
Now we come to the most important question: so which of the listed materials will suit us?
Here it is worth being guided by such moments:
- If the cost allows - feel free to take arbolit. Let you spend a little more time on the construction of the "box", but save on additional weatherization.
- Also you should not risk using aerated concrete on mobile soils, especially if you do not plan to install a powerful foundation.
- In all other cases, the use of aerated concrete blocks is quite acceptable. Naturally, here you need to be very careful about heat engineering calculations, because the cost of heat insulation for aerated concrete blocks can "eat" all the economic benefits.
